🐟 Physical Description

Dorsal spines (total): 0; Dorsal soft rays (total): 9 - 11; Anal spines: 0; Anal soft rays: 8 - 10; Vertebrae: 39. Diagnosis: body a little depressed in front , elongate, fusiform , its depth 5.66 - 9.1 times in TL, 8.5-9.1 times in SL , 10.8-14.5% SL, with greatest depth at or slightly anterior to dorsal fin origin . Head broader than deep, about 1.5 times as long as broad, its length 4.5-5 times in TL , 17.2-21.7% SL . Snout rounded, about as long as postorbital part of head , 2.35-2.8 times in HL . Eye superolateral, 3.75 - 5.75 times in HL, 1.3-1.75 times in interorbital distance, 1.65-2.45 times in snout length . Interorbital width 28.6-45.1% HL , 3.2-3.55 times in HL . Dorsal fin 1.2-1.3 times further from snout tip than from caudal fin origin , at equal distance from eye and root of caudal . Anal fin origin 2 - 2.4 times as distant from root of pelvics as from root of caudal. Pectoral fin paddle shaped , very large, 4-4.75 times in SL, 0.95- 1.2 times in HL . Pelvic fin 4.85-6.25 times in SL, 1-1.35 times in HL . Caudal peduncle about 1.45 - 1.66 times as long as deep. : elongated; Cross section: circular.
